### Step 4: Point producers at the registry

Each service that emits events must now validate payloads against Welkinford Registry before publishing. Update your producer library to v3 or later; older clients will be rejected at the broker. Compatibility mode is BACKWARD for all subjects during the transition. Once the library is upgraded, set your service's registry configuration to the following values.

settings of kajep-kawip:
[zorys]
host = zorys.urlaqgrid.corp
user = zorys_svc
database = zorys_prod

## Pricing: the Marlowe Line (Managers Only)

Heads up, sales leads — Marlowe pricing is shifting. List price moves up 6% next quarter, but we're adding a bundled tier that should soften the blow for repeat buyers. Discounts above 10% still need regional sign-off, no exceptions. Cheat sheets are being refreshed now. Hold off on quoting new deals until you've read the note below.

internal memo for kawip-hadug: Headcount on the Wenwyn team goes from 7 to 140 by the end of January. Gross margin on Wenwyn came in at 20 percent against a plan of 15 percent.

## Authentication

Renderspray caches compiled templates per tenant; cold renders cost ~40ms, warm renders under 2ms. Auth adds no measurable overhead because tokens are validated against the in-process Gatelet cache, refreshed every 60s. Reviewers: confirm the benchmark harness uses the warm path, otherwise numbers are misleading. The harness authenticates to the internal Gatelet endpoint with the key below.

gateway credential: kto23_LX9A4ys6i4nzHtpOLNLodKK

Facilities Ticket — Ostrell Point, Level 6

Roof-terrace door jams when humidity is high. Joinery repair booked with Fenbrook Services for next Tuesday. Reception: check the terrace at closing to ensure no one is locked out. If the door sticks shut, use the emergency keypad beside the planter to release the latch. The keypad accepts the following code.

staff pass of kawip-hawef = bdg-QLP-2